Lynden Christian’s six-run fifth inning powered it to an 8-5 win over Nooksack Valley on Friday, April 12 at Lynden Christian High School.
Senior Jonah Terpstra, junior Eli Maberry and sophomore Austin Engels each logged two hits for the Lyncs, while Engels also had two RBIs. LC won its fourth game in the last five.
Senior Eduardo Cerda led NV, finishing 2 for 4 with a run scored and an RBI. Junior Colby Martin went 2 for 4 with two RBIs.
LC bounced back from a demoralizing shutout loss to Anacortes that snapped a three-game win streak. The Lyncs’ next game will be against Mount Baker (2-10, 1-8 Northwest Conference) on the road at 4:30 p.m. on Tuesday, April 16.
NV’s next game will be a home contest against against Blaine (7-6, 3-6 NWC) at 6 pm. on Tuesday, April 16.
